Kinetus

Eldari of Motion

Appearance

Kinetus, the Eldari of Force and Motion, was entirely immaterial, existing only as the feeling of movement and gravity itself. He did not possess a tangible-adjacent form like some of his fellow Eldari, but his presence was unmistakable, felt in the pull of gravity and the movement of celestial bodies. It is believed that the clustering of galaxies reflects his form, a manifestation of the forces that hold the cosmos together. Kinetus’ essence was gravity—the invisible hand guiding the stars and planets in their eternal dance across the universe.

Origin

Kinetus was born from the dream of Azhorra'tha, the Watcher in the Abyss, as one of the primordial Eldari created to embody the elemental forces that shaped the universe. While others represented more tangible elements like energy and matter, Kinetus was the essence of motion, the force that gave the stars their paths, the planets their orbits, and the galaxies their clustering. He existed to keep the universe in constant motion, ensuring that all things would move in harmony with one another.

During Primordial Pandemonium, Kinetus clashed with his fellow Eldari, his forces of motion creating violent collisions of celestial bodies and cataclysmic shifts in nebulae as gravity and inertia collided with other elemental forces. His influence was paramount to the structure of the cosmos, as without the exertion of gravity, there could be no life, no creation, and no time.

Existence

After the Solis Singularity, where the chaotic forces of the Eldari were brought into order, Kinetus was transmuted into the very force of gravity itself. His essence now exists as the invisible binding force that holds the planes of existence together and maintains the fragile balance of the cosmos. The clustering of galaxies, the rotation of planets, and the movement of nebulae—all are reflections of Kinetus' enduring influence.

Though he no longer exists as a sentient being, his essence is omnipresent in the universe, sustaining the forces that keep the cosmos from unraveling. His essence was further merged with Zephyr, the Eldari of Space, to create the space and gravity that surrounds the Continuum Crystal Cosmology. Together, they form the fabric of space and motion that sustains the universe. 

Kinetus’ essence was also transmuted into two elemental planes:

The Plane of Aquos, representing fluid motion as an endless sea with immeasurable gravity.

The Plane of Zephyron, symbolizing free motion as an infinite sky with limited gravity, moved only by the gales of wind from Zephyr.

Additionally, this union would result in the creation of Aether (God of Air) and Hydrus (God of Water) in addition to their respective planes of existence.

Powers and Abilities

As the embodiment of Force and Motion, Kinetus controlled the very gravity that holds the universe together. His influence dictated the orbits of planets, the clustering of galaxies, and the movement of stars. Without his presence, the universe would collapse into stillness, devoid of the energy needed to sustain creation.

Kinetus was the driving force behind every action in the cosmos. He gave the stars their movement, fueled the force of inertia, and ensured that all things moved in harmony. His power was felt in every galaxy and every nebula, as his gravitational influence shaped the celestial bodies.

Connections

  • Prism: Kinetus was deeply connected to Prism, the Eldari of Symmetry and Order. While Kinetus provided the motion and force that guided the universe, Prism maintained the order of these forces, ensuring that the cosmos did not descend into chaos.
  • Ignis: The Eldari of Energy and Heat was also closely tied to Kinetus, as the stars' gravitational pull, fueled by Ignis' energy, powered the movement of celestial bodies.
  • Zephyr: Kinetus and Zephyr were intimately connected, as gravity and space are inseparable forces. Together, they shaped the fabric of the cosmos, creating the vast expanses of space and the gravitational forces that moved within it.
  • The Continuum Crystal Cosmology: Kinetus' force was essential to the creation of the Continuum Crystal Cosmology. His essence binds the realms together, keeping the balance of gravity and motion intact across the various planes of existence.

Legacy and Legends

Kinetus' influence is felt in every aspect of the universe. Though he no longer exists as a conscious being, his essence continues to sustain the forces that keep the cosmos in motion. The legends of Kinetus speak of his role in shaping the movement of the stars and planets, and his enduring presence in the gravitational forces that bind the realms together.

During the Second Age: Twilight of Creation, Kinetus' remnants gave rise to Force Apparitions, titanic beings of immense gravity and motion who clashed with the Pantheon of Primus and the Dragon Realms. These beings, though destructive, were a reflection of Kinetus' enduring power over the universe's motion.
